Natural Sources: Boosting Serotonin Through Diet
Serotonin boosting naturally through dietary means is a powerful tool for cultivating optimal mental health and overall well-being. Serotonin, often dubbed the "feel-good" neurotransmitter, plays a pivotal role in regulating mood, appetite, sleep, and other physiological processes. While prescription medications can address serotonin deficiency, prioritizing natural serotonin boosters offers a holistic health approach with significant advantages. These include reduced reliance on pharmaceuticals, potential for broader positive lifestyle changes, and the benefit of cultivating long-term mental resilience.
Natural sources like tryptophan-rich foods serve as building blocks for serotonin production in the brain. Tryptophan is an essential amino acid that cannot be synthesized by the body and must be obtained through diet. Incorporating foods such as turkey, eggs, bananas, nuts, seeds, and whole grains can significantly enhance serotonergic activity. Additionally, certain nutrients like vitamin B6, magnesium, and zinc play crucial supporting roles in serotonin synthesis. A balanced diet enriched with these nutritional elements not only facilitates serotonin production but also promotes overall physiological balance.
